Yes, a person can steal your identification with your government-issued ID or vehicle driver's permit. (PII) including your full name, home address, day of birth, image or even your signature can be made use of to swipe your identification and target you with phishing frauds.

Imagine your motorist's certificate number comes to be jeopardized and drops into the hands of a person that makes duplicates of your ID and then markets them to criminals. If a criminal gets captured for any type of criminal activity with your ID, police could place those fees on your record rather than theirs. This scenario is very dangerous because it will be challenging to confirm that you really did not devote those crimes given that one more individual has your ID.

If a person has your ID, they can use your full name to look you up and find your email address or telephone number. Once they have means to call you, someone could send you a fake message about dubious task in your checking account or a concern with a social media account.

You can tell if somebody is using your lost or swiped ID for harmful purposes by observing the following: A new car loan or credit line that you did not license shows up on your credit score record, showing that a person has utilized your ID to devote fraud You can not visit to your on-line accounts, recommending that a person used your ID and details related to your ID to jeopardize your accounts You stop receiving mail, which could be an indication someone has actually altered the address on your ID to match theirs You begin receiving phone calls from financial obligation collection agencies concerning debt that isn't your own, meaning somebody has utilized your ID to impersonate you and been authorized for bank card or car loans Your financial institution alerts you of fraudulent task, which means someone has actually used your ID to withdraw big amounts of money or make unapproved transactions There are several points you ought to do if your ID has been shed or swiped, such as reporting the loss or theft to your state's DMV, cold your credit scores and submitting a record with the Federal Profession Payment (FTC).
